UNICORN INTERNATIONAL LIMITED Trademarks
UNICORN
Filed: June 7, 2017
Lace; Embroidery; ribbons; braids; buttons; hooks and eyes; pins, namely, sewing pins, hat pins, curling pins, safety pins…
Owned by: UNICORN INTERNATIONAL LIMITED
Serial Number: 87479823